Factors Affecting Cost Estimates

Replacing a church roof in Contra Costa County involves several key considerations to ensure a durable and compliant installation. Understanding the typical scope and factors involved can help in planning and comparing project options effectively.

  • Materials: Common roofing materials include asphalt shingles, clay tiles, and metal panels, each offering different durability and aesthetic options suitable for religious buildings.
  • Size and Scope: Project size varies based on the church’s roof dimensions, complexity of design, and any additional features such as steeples or dormers.
  • Labor Complexity: Roof replacement may involve complex scaffolding, removal of existing roofing layers, and specialized installation techniques, especially for historic or architecturally intricate structures.
  • Permitting: Local permits are typically required to ensure compliance with Contra Costa County building codes and regulations, which may include inspections and approvals prior to work commencement.
  • Additional Services: Optional extras can include roof insulation upgrades, venting systems, gutter replacements, and weatherproofing, which can impact overall project costs and scope.

Scope and Scale Considerations

Church Roof Replacement

Scope/Size Typical Range
Small church (less than 2,000 sq ft) $20,000 - $50,000
Medium church (2,000 - 5,000 sq ft) $50,000 - $150,000
Large church (more than 5,000 sq ft) $150,000 - $400,000
Complex roof designs or materials Additional costs may apply
Roof removal and disposal Part of overall project costs

Project costs for church roof replacements in Contra Costa County can vary based on size, design complexity, and material choices.
